# Break-Glass: Catalog Cache Invalidation

Scope: the Pinrow product catalog at Veldstone Retail. If stale prices persist after a purge and the Hollowmere invalidation queue is wedged, use break-glass to flush the edge tier directly. Contractors: get verbal sign-off from the catalog lead first. Steps: open the Hollowmere admin shell, select emergency-flush, confirm the tenant, and run it once — repeated flushes thrash the origin. Access is logged and expires after 20 minutes. Unseal the admin shell with the passphrase below.

recovery phrase for kahop-tajog: istix-casvan

Subject: DR drill — vendored fonts edition. Hi Tomas, quick heads-up for next week's drill at Pinefold: we're restoring the Glyphhaven build from cold storage, including the vendored third-party fonts, to prove releases don't depend on upstream mirrors. Font bundle checksums are in the drill doc. The cold-storage archive is encrypted, and the recovery passphrase you'll need is just below.

vault phrase of tajop-haduf = holath-brivan-wenax

# RateSentinel settings — hotel rate-parity checker.
# Crawls partner feeds hourly, flags price deltas over threshold.
# Do not lower the crawl interval; partners throttle hard.
# Parity results are written in batches of 500; partial batches
# flush on shutdown. Schema migrations run automatically at boot.
# Results are persisted to the parity database via the connection string below.

replica DSN, kajep-yahag: mssql://praok_svc:iF@db-8d68.plorvaio.local:5432/eliion

Handover Note — Pricing, Brellow Line

Welcome aboard! Quick context: we repriced the Brellow mid-tier in spring, and uptake held steady despite grumbling from resellers in the Caldmoor region. The premium tier still undercuts our costs on support-heavy accounts — that's your first headache. Fenna has the full models. For where we're headed next, see the confidential note below.

internal memo for kawip-hadug: Headcount on the Wenwyn team goes from 7 to 140 by the end of January. Gross margin on Wenwyn came in at 20 percent against a plan of 15 percent.